Dragon Ball GT Episode 54: The Four-Star Dragon

The Four-Star Dragon

EpisodeEp. 54

With four Dragon Balls recovered, Goku and Pan face Nuova Shenron, the Four-Star Dragon of Fire. His body reaches temperatures hotter than the sun, making physical attacks dangerous. When Pan is knocked out, Nuova spares her life, hinting at an honor code unlike any previous Shadow Dragon. Meanwhile, a second dragon lurks in the shadows.

The Warrior of Flame

Giru locates the next Dragon Ball in a nearby city, where Nuova Shenron awaits. Pan, overconfident from four straight victories, charges in alone and is instantly knocked unconscious. Goku demands that Nuova put Pan down, but the fire dragon quietly places her out of harm's way, sparing her life without being asked. He reveals that the wish that created him was when the evil King Piccolo wished for his youth to be restored.

Goku and Nuova begin their battle, and Goku quickly discovers a severe problem. The dragon's body generates temperatures beyond even the sun. Punching him burns Goku's hand, and kicking him threatens to melt his feet. Every physical strike carries a painful cost.

Solar Powered

Goku ducks into a building to plan a counterattack, but Nuova stays on him relentlessly. When they return outside, Goku learns that Nuova draws energy directly from the sun, giving him a limitless power supply. Goku tries a Solar Flare, but the blinding light does nothing to a dragon made of fire.

Nuova cracks open his outer shell and accesses his full power, prompting Goku to answer with Super Saiyan 4. The true battle between fire and Saiyan power is about to begin. Meanwhile, Giru watches over the unconscious Pan when another Shadow Dragon attacks from the darkness, stealing the collected Dragon Balls and injuring Pan further.

A Lurking Threat

The identity of Pan's attacker remains unclear, but the stolen Dragon Balls represent a devastating setback. Giru is damaged in the ambush, and Pan lies battered on the ground. Everything the group has fought to collect is now in enemy hands, and Goku does not yet know what has happened behind his back.

Nuova Shenron stands out among the Shadow Dragons for his willingness to fight with honor, sparing the innocent and facing opponents directly. But the arrival of a second dragon in the shadows signals that the battles ahead will not be so clean. Episode 54 sets the stage for a collision of fire, ice, and Saiyan pride.
